Make copies of DVD

I had put my home movies on DVD by a professional. I only had a copy of each and now I would like to make a few copies of each of my children. I would do it on my laptop (which has a disk drive). I guess I'll have to burn all of them on the hard drive and then burn it to a blank disc from there, but I don't know exactly how to proceed and would like advice to facilitate this.

If the DVDs are not copy protected information
can be useful.

First... just a suggestion... using a slow burn speed
produces a more reliable copy.

If you have software like Nero installed may have
an option for copying DVDs.

Also, the following method can be your answer...
(at least it works for me).

The following freeware can create an ISO Image
that allows to burn copies. Once you have the
image created... you can use it to burn as many copies
as you need.

    Here's how to copy DVD and burn: (these steps will be useful if your DVD is capable of burning DVDs)

    a. right-click on the DVD drive icon, and select Explorer.

    b. Select all the files and right click on them. Now, select copy.

    c. now, go to the location where you want to paste. Right-click on the free space and select Paste.

    d. now, insert a new DVD.

    e. now open the DVD in Windows Explorer.

    f. copy all the files you want to burn and then right-click on the free space on the Windows DVD and select Paste.

    g. you must click on the "write these files to DVD" link in the upper left corner of the window.

    h. the Assistant burn a DVD appears and asks you to name the CD\DVD. Insert a name or leave the default and click Next.

    i. wait until the burning process is complete.

  • Menu copy Deskjet F4140 won't make copies.

    I recently updated my Macbook Pro to Lion... Mac Os X 10.7.4 now my menu copy of HP don't make copies... it gives me an error message that says no default device not connected.  Help

    If you are using Snow Leopard or Lion and you have the HP software before Snow Leopard (either from a CD that is not marked as compatible with the 10.6/10.7 or you recently upgraded to Snow Leopard or Lion and had the software HP on your Mac before you upgrade - even if you made a standard from the old software uninstaller or installed new software on top of it) , you must uninstall the software by using the "scrubber":

    Go to Applications/Hewlett Packard / click Uninstall HP
    Click on continue
    Highlight your device in the left pane
    Press and hold Ctrl + Alt + Cmd keys on the keyboard at the same time as you click on uninstall< this="" is="" the="" scrubber="" option,="" there="" is="" no="" button="" labeled="">
    There will be a pop up that asks if you are sure you want to uninstall all hp software. (At this point, if you continue, all HP printers you have installed will need to be reinstalled)
    Click on continue and let it finish

    Download and install this: http://support.apple.com/kb/DL907

    Restart your Mac.

    Now reset the printing system:

    -Sys Prefs, Print & Fax
    -Right (control) click inside the box that lists your printers and select Reset Printing System.
    WARNING - This will remove ALL your printers!
    -Select the sign + to add again. Search for the printer, select it, and wait until the button 'Add' becomes available. Until it clicks.

  • ASM actively to avoid hot spots and make copies of archived newspapers?

    Hi all

    I have two small question, I hope.

    1 ASM avoid hot spots of rebalancing active files, or the re - balance does when records are added and deleted? I believe that ASM is not "actively" hot spots in this way, simply avoids through its design, i.e. striping of files/entries across all the LUNS in a disc of the group, but need to confirm my manager.

    2 using external redundancy, ASM does make copies of the archived redo logs?

    Thank you
    Stuart

    ASM avoids implicitly "hotspots" using the SAME methodology to strip everything on all the disks in the disk group, you are the answer is Yes. A rebalancing operation is necessary when the disks are added or removed from the disk group, if the number of disks does not change then the files will be always balanced on these discs (hope makes sense).

    External redundancy faces ASM does nothing with the creation of redundant copies of all files, external redundancy means that you use RAID protection at the level of storage (e.g. RAID1), so ideally all data written to the asm disks is reflected at the level of storage on redundant disks in the RAID group. With external redundancy, the only way ASM will write two copies of a newspaper to check is if you tell the database to write in two places on ASM disks.
